Output 85ffdda6fd1352a22eb56d9f884fd8f604b0e1ac8cc7d17da3c771ed96e4f0de:0

value
118397330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c8b795d1928e99d8c51c7e916220eab4ac450aa OP_EQUAL
address
3Bawz6BeRRraAn3N5urZc3ebmk2dXY1jrX
transaction
85ffdda6fd1352a22eb56d9f884fd8f604b0e1ac8cc7d17da3c771ed96e4f0de
confirmations
384473
spent
true